Description

Elektrischer Gasreiniger. Bei elektrischen Gasreinigern ist es bekannt, zur Verteilung des Gasstromes auf den Durchgangsquerschnitt des Apparates an der Gaseinmündung Leitflächen vorzusehen. Die Leitflächen werden nun gemäß der Erfindung zur Aufhängung der Ausströmerelektroden bzw. dazu benutzt, die elektrische Verbindung zwischen den Ausströmern und der Hochspannungszuleitung herzustellen.Electric gas purifier. In the case of electric gas cleaners, it is known to distribute the gas flow over the passage cross-section of the apparatus at the Provide gas junction guide surfaces. The baffles are now according to the invention used to suspend the outflow electrodes or to establish the electrical connection between the vents and the high-voltage supply line.

Man hat schon vorgeschlagen, die Elektroden elektrischer Gasreiniger an Platten aufzuhängen. Diese bekannten Platten sind aber keine Gasverteiler, die insbesondere bei röhrenförmigen Sammelelektroden für eine gleichmäßige Verteilung des einströmenden Gases auf den Gesamtdurchgangsquerschnitt der Niederschlagsvorrichtung sorgen, sondern haben lediglich den Zweck, als parallel zum Gasstrom liegende Flächen den Isolatorenraum vom Gaskanal abzusperren oder bei Querstellung zur Gasströmung als Prallflächen den Gasstrom von den toten Räumen des Gaskanals fernzuhalten. Im Gegensatz hierzu kommt es bei der Erfindung darauf an, die an sich bekannten, an der Gaseinmündung vorgesehenen Gasverteilungsflächen als Trag- bzw. als Stromleitvorrichtung für die Hochspannungselektroden nutzbar zu machen.It has already been proposed to use electrical gas purifiers for the electrodes to hang on plates. However, these known plates are not gas distributors that especially with tubular collecting electrodes for an even distribution of the inflowing gas on the total passage cross section of the precipitation device care, but only have the purpose of being parallel to the gas flow lying surfaces to shut off the isolator space from the gas duct or in the case of a position transverse to the gas flow as baffles to keep the gas flow away from the dead spaces of the gas duct. in the In contrast to this, what matters in the invention are those known per se the gas opening provided gas distribution surfaces as a support or as a current conducting device to make it usable for the high-voltage electrodes.

Die Zeichnung zeigt ein Ausführungsbeispiel der Erfindung, und zwar in Abb. x im senkrechten Längsschnitt und in Abb. 2 im Grundriß.The drawing shows an embodiment of the invention, namely in Fig. x in vertical longitudinal section and in Fig. 2 in plan.

Der Gasreiniger x mit den drahtförmigen Ausströmern 2 und den rohrförmigen Sammelelektroden 3 ist mit dem üblichen GaseinlaßrOhr 4 versehen. An der Einmündungsstelle dieses Rohrs in den Reiniger sitzen Leitflächen 5, die den Gasstrom in der durch die Pfeile angedeuteten Weise auf den ganzen Querschnitt des Reinigers z verteilen.The gas cleaner x with the wire-shaped outlets 2 and the tubular Collector electrodes 3 are provided with the usual gas inlet tube 4. At the junction this pipe in the cleaner sit baffles 5, which the gas flow in the through Distribute the arrows over the entire cross-section of the cleaner z as indicated.

Die Leitflächen 5 sind erfindungsgemäß so angeordnet und ausgebildet, daß sie die Ausströmerelektroden 2 tragen und zur Zuleitung der Hochspannung dienen. Die Bleche 5 sind zu diesem Zweck an den Hochspannung führenden, von den Isolatoren 7 getragenen Querschienen 6 aufgehängt.According to the invention, the guide surfaces 5 are arranged and designed in such a way that that they carry the outflow electrodes 2 and serve to supply the high voltage. For this purpose, the metal sheets 5 are connected to the high voltage leading from the insulators 7 worn cross rails 6 suspended.

Die Erfindung ist selbstverständlich auch bei Gasreinigern mit plattenförmigen Sammelelektroden anwendbar. Ferner kann die Zuführung des Gases statt von oben auch von unten oder von der Seite her erfolgen.The invention is of course also in gas cleaners with plate-shaped Collective electrodes applicable. Furthermore, the gas can also be supplied instead of from above from below or from the side.

Es ist nicht notwendig, die Leitflächen auf dem elektrischen Potential der Ausströmerelektroden zu halten, vielmehr können die Flächen 5 aus Isolierteilen bestehen. In diesem Fall müßte in anderer Weise für die elektrische Verbindung zwischen den Querschienen 6 und den Ausströmern 2 gesorgt werden. Die Leitflächen 5 brauchen auch nicht bis an die Querschienen 6 zu reichen, sofern sie nur als Elektrodentragvorrichtung dienen.It is not necessary to put the conductive surfaces on the electrical potential To keep the outflow electrodes, rather the surfaces 5 can be made of insulating parts exist. In this case would have to be done in a different way for the electrical connection between the cross rails 6 and the outlets 2 are taken care of. The guide surfaces 5 need also not to extend to the cross rails 6, provided they are only used as an electrode support device to serve.

Claims (2)

PATENT-A.NSPRÜCHE: i. Elektrischer Gasreiniger mit Leitflächen an der Gaseinmündung, dadurch gekennzeichnet, daß die Leitflächen die Ausströmerelektroden tragen. PATENT CLAIMS: i. Electric gas cleaner with baffles on the gas confluence, characterized in that the guide surfaces are the outflow electrodes wear. 2. Elektrischer Gasreiniger nach Anspruch i, dadurch gekennzeichnet, daß die Leitflächen auf dem elektrischen Potential der Ausströmerelektroden gehalten werden.2. Electric gas cleaner according to claim i, characterized in that the guide surfaces are kept at the electrical potential of the outflow electrodes will.
